ABSTRACT:
A reel and bending apparatus and method for laying pipelines from a floating vessel on the floor of a body of water in which the pipeline is capable of being unreeled from either the top or bottom of the reel and then translated through two pair of independently housed horizontally disposed rollers working in conjunction with the reel for straightening the pipe in the vertical plane.
